The Funeral Services were 3 P.M. Saturday February 23, 2019 at Elgin Baptist Church by the Rev. Todd Rudisill with burial at Lancaster Memorial Park.
The Family will received friends from 2-3 P.M. at the church before services.
She was born October 16, 1927 in Lancaster County of the Fork Hill Community, a daughter of the late Hunter Blackmon and Bertha Couch Blackmon, and was married to the late Sam Gainey.
Mrs. Gainey is survived by 3 sons Rickey Gainey and wife Judy, Barry Gainey and wife Debbie, and Sandy Gainey all of Lancaster, 4 Daughters Vivian B. Flouhouse and husband Clint of Charlotte, N.C., Denise Beaver and husband Douglas, Dianne Driver and husband Dennis, and Marilyn G. Ellis and husband Doug, 15 Grandchildren, 30 Great-Grandchildren and 5 Great Great Grandchildren, 1 Brother Alva Blackmon and wife Ann, and 1 Sister Elvis Ray, both of Lancaster.
She was preceded in death by 2 Grandsons Darren Sean Beecher (46553053) and Andrew David Beecher(46553039).
